線上訂房服務-台灣趴趴狗聯合訂房中心
發文 回覆 瀏覽次數:1240
推到 Plurk!
推到 Facebook!

如何不靠 VCL 建立一個 Window?

尚未結案
RogerHer
一般會員


發表:11
回覆:39
積分:10
註冊:2002-03-13

發送簡訊給我
#1 引用回覆 回覆 發表時間:2002-11-05 12:49:19 IP:202.145.xxx.xxx 未訂閱
Dear All, 不知道各位在網路上有沒有看過一些桌面佈景程式可以提供使用者自行設計 WIndows 視窗的外觀,而不再是規規矩矩的四方形,我曾經試著自己做做看,試著改寫 WM_NCACTIVATE,WM_NCPAINT,WM_PAINT,WM_SETTEXT,WM_NCHITEST,WM_ERASEBKGND等訊息處理常式,如些雖然可以完成我想要的自定視窗外觀的功能,但是當我用滑鼠拖拉改變視窗大小時,卻發現視窗閃爍的很厲害,所以我想可能是 VCL 的 TForm 元件做了一些額外的處理,所以我想試著不靠 VCL 來建立視窗,看可不可以改善這個問題.
zwaves
一般會員


發表:0
回覆:1
積分:0
註冊:2002-11-10

發送簡訊給我
#2 引用回覆 回覆 發表時間:2002-11-12 20:49:06 IP:61.183.xxx.xxx 未訂閱
好象在VC环境下直接用WinAPI写程式也有这样的问题,可能并非是VCL的原因。 我听说过有人写过一个读书程序,当程序自动滚屏时屏幕闪烁得厉害,结果他最后调用了DiectX的方法解决了这个问题。具体怎么解决的就不清楚了。
系統時間:2024-04-27 11:49:03
聯絡我們 | Delphi K.Top討論版
本站聲明
1. 本論壇為無營利行為之開放平台,所有文章都是由網友自行張貼,如牽涉到法律糾紛一切與本站無關。
2. 假如網友發表之內容涉及侵權,而損及您的利益,請立即通知版主刪除。
3. 請勿批評中華民國元首及政府或批評各政黨,是藍是綠本站無權干涉,但這裡不是政治性論壇!